阿里云架设代理服务器,首先需要购买并配置ECS(弹性计算服务)实例,然后在实例上安装并配置代理软件,如Squid或Nginx,具体步骤包括:在阿里云管理控制台创建ECS实例,选择操作系统和配置;通过SSH登录ECS实例,安装代理软件;配置代理软件,设置监听端口、缓存路径等参数;测试代理服务器是否成功,还需注意网络安全问题,如设置防火墙规则,确保只有允许的IP地址可以访问代理服务器,通过本文的实战操作指南,用户可以轻松在阿里云上搭建自己的代理服务器,实现网络加速和访问控制等功能。
在数字化时代,网络代理服务器成为了连接不同网络环境、保障数据传输安全与效率的重要工具,阿里云,作为全球领先的云计算服务提供商,提供了丰富的云服务,其中就包括代理服务器的架设服务,本文将详细介绍如何在阿里云上搭建一个高效、安全的代理服务器,包括选择适合的解决方案、配置步骤、安全优化以及监控管理等方面。
选择适合的阿里云代理服务方案
阿里云提供了多种代理服务解决方案,如SLB(Server Load Balancer)、NAT Gateway、VPN网关等,每种方案都有其特定的应用场景和优势。
- SLB(Server Load Balancer):适用于需要将流量分发到多台服务器以均衡负载的场景,它支持多种协议,提供高并发处理能力,是构建应用层代理的理想选择。
- NAT Gateway:适用于需要对外提供统一出口IP的场景,如出口流量过滤、安全策略管理等,它支持TCP/UDP协议,适用于各种网络应用。
- VPN网关:适用于需要在不同网络环境间建立安全通道的场景,如分支机构与总部之间的数据传输,支持IPSec、SSL等多种VPN协议。
SLB(Server Load Balancer)配置实战
创建SLB实例
- 登录阿里云管理控制台,进入“SLB”服务。
- 点击“创建负载均衡”,选择“经典网络”或“专有网络”,并配置区域、实例名称、规格(如负载均衡类型、带宽等)。
- 配置安全组,确保所需端口对内外开放。
监听器配置
- 在SLB实例下,点击“添加监听”,设置监听端口(如HTTP默认为80,HTTPS为443)。
- 选择SSL证书(如果使用HTTPS),或配置默认的HTTP转发规则。
后端服务器配置
- 进入“后端服务器”页面,点击“添加服务器”,输入ECS实例ID、资源组或IP地址。
- 配置健康检查,包括检查间隔、失败阈值等参数。
路由配置(可选)
根据需求,可以创建自定义路由规则,实现基于URL、域名或请求头的流量分发。
NAT Gateway配置实战
创建NAT网关
- 在阿里云控制台进入“NAT网关”服务。
- 点击“创建NAT网关”,选择对应的网络类型(经典网络/专有网络)、区域及规格。
- 等待NAT网关创建完成并获取公网IP。
添加SNAT规则
- 进入NAT网关详情页,点击“添加SNAT规则”。
- 选择需要转换的私网IP段,并指定公网IP作为源IP。
配置ACL(访问控制列表)
根据需要,为NAT网关添加ACL规则,控制入站和出站流量,增强安全性。
VPN网关配置实战——以IPSec VPN为例
创建VPN网关
- 进入“VPN网关”服务,点击“创建VPN网关”,选择区域、网络类型及规格。
- 创建完成后,记录VPN网关的ID和公网IP地址。
配置IPSec参数
- 在VPN网关详情页,点击“配置IPSec参数”,设置PSK(预共享密钥)、加密方式及隧道模式等。
- 保存配置并等待状态变为“运行中”。
对端配置与连接测试
在本地网络或远程端设备上配置IPSec客户端,输入阿里云VPN网关的公网IP、PSK等信息,进行连接测试,确保双方能够成功建立隧道连接。
安全优化与监控管理
安全优化:
- SSL/TLS加密:对于所有对外服务,建议使用SSL/TLS加密,确保数据传输的安全性,阿里云提供了免费的SSL证书服务。
- 访问控制:通过安全组、ACL规则等限制访问权限,仅开放必要的端口和IP范围。
- DDoS防护:启用DDoS防护服务,有效抵御网络攻击,保护服务器稳定运行。
- 定期审计:定期对代理服务器的日志进行审计,检查异常访问行为并及时处理。
监控管理:
- 阿里云控制台监控:利用阿里云提供的监控服务,实时监控SLB、NAT网关及VPN网关的流量、状态等指标。
- 自定义告警:根据监控指标设置告警规则,如带宽使用率超过阈值、连接数异常等,及时接收通知并采取应对措施。
- 日志分析:利用阿里云日志服务(SLS)收集并分析代理服务器的访问日志、错误日志等,便于故障排查和性能优化。
总结与展望
通过本文的详细介绍和实战操作指南,相信您已经掌握了在阿里云上搭建代理服务器的全过程,无论是用于负载均衡、流量转发还是安全隔离,阿里云提供的丰富代理服务方案都能满足您的需求,未来随着云计算技术的不断发展,阿里云的代理服务也将持续进化,为用户提供更加高效、灵活的网络解决方案,建议持续关注阿里云官方文档和公告,以获取最新的产品更新和最佳实践信息。